The Australian government has given the green light for a feasibility study by academics and industry leaders into the creation of a renewable hydrogen supply chain between Germany and Australia.

A consortium led by the University of New South Wales (UNSW), Deloitte, and Baringa Partners will work with German counterparts to analyse the production, storage, and transportation of the fuel source. They will also identify the barriers and the optimal approaches that both countries can use to establish a viable energy collaboration.
